New York City FC Forward Ismael Tajouri-Shradi Agrees to New Contract

New York City FC announced that Ismael Tajouri-Shradi has agreed to a new multi-year contract with the Club. The Libyan international has played 52 matches across all competitions over the past two seasons, scoring 19 goals and adding seven assists.
